Hot Crab Dip

Contributed By: Michele
Light & Tasty Magazine

This is a perfect recipe for a party or potluck.

Ingredients

1/2 cup Milk

1/3 cup Salsa

3 packages (8 oz each) cream cheese, cubed

2 packages (8 oz each) imitation crabmeat, flaked

1 cup Thinly sliced green onions

1 can (4 oz) chopped green chilies

Assorted crackers

Preparation

Combine milk and salsa. Transfer to a slow cooker coated with nonstick cooking spray. Stir in cream cheese, crab, onions, and chilies. Cover and cook on low for 3-4 hours, stirring every 30 minutes. Serve with crackers. Makes about 5 cups.

Cook's Notes

This makes a lot. The nutrient information is for one 1/4 cup serving if prepared with skim milk, light cream cheese, and calculated without crackers. Diabetic exchanges: 1 lean meat, 1 vegetable.
